As we progress our series, let’s delve into the world of AI-driven A/B testing and experiments – a critical component for optimizing marketing strategies. In a landscape where consumer preferences shift rapidly, the ability to test, learn, and adapt is invaluable.

AI significantly amplifies this capability, providing insights and efficiency beyond traditional testing methods. A/B testing, the process of comparing two versions of a webpage, email, or ad to see which performs better, is a staple in the marketer’s toolkit.

AI elevates this process by automating and optimizing various aspects of the testing. For instance, AI can manage multiple tests simultaneously, quickly analyze results, and even predict outcomes based on early data trends.

This level of automation and analysis allows for more rapid iteration and optimization of your marketing strategies. One of the key advantages of AI-driven A/B testing is the ability to personalize experiences at an individual level.

Traditional A/B testing often segments audiences into broad groups, but AI can drill down to a much more granular level. This means you can test and tailor your marketing efforts not just to segments, but to individual preferences, enhancing the effectiveness of your personalization strategies.

AI also extends the scope of experimentation beyond simple A/B tests. It can conduct complex multivariate testing, where multiple variables are tested simultaneously to understand how they interact with each other.

This approach provides a more holistic view of what elements work best in combination, offering deeper insights into effective marketing strategies. AI-driven testing can adapt in real-time. If certain variations are underperforming, AI algorithms can automatically adjust the distribution of traffic to focus on more promising options.

This dynamic approach ensures that your marketing resources are always optimized for the best possible outcomes. However, while AI-driven A/B testing offers powerful advantages, it’s important to approach it with a strategy.

Define clear objectives for your tests, ensure that your hypotheses are well-thought-out, and be prepared to act on the insights generated. AI can provide the data and predictions, but the strategic decisions still rest in your hands.

AI-driven A/B testing and experiments are transforming the way marketers optimize their strategies. They offer a level of personalization, efficiency, and insight that traditional methods cannot match.

By embracing AI in your testing processes, you can ensure that your marketing efforts are continually refined and aligned with the evolving preferences of your audience.
